Sleep-disordered breathing is common in stroke and may negatively affect its outcome. Screening for sleep-disordered breathing in this setting is of interest but poorly studied. We aimed to evaluate the performance of eight obstructive sleep apnea screening questionnaires to predict sleep-disordered breathing in acute stroke or transient ischaemic attack patients, and to assess the impact of stroke/transient ischaemic attack-specific factors on sleep-disordered breathing prediction.

Sleep-disordered breathing (SDB) is linked to cognitive dysfunction. Although SDB is common in stroke patients, the impact of SDB and its early treatment on cognitive functioning after stroke remains poorly investigated. Therefore, we explored the association between SDB and post-stroke cognitive functioning, including the impact of early SDB treatment with adaptive servo-ventilation (ASV) on cognitive recovery from acute event to 3 months post-stroke.

Background: Sleep-disordered breathing (SDB) and atrial fibrillation (AF) are highly prevalent in patients with stroke and are recognized as independent risk factors for stroke. Little is known about the impact of comorbid SDB and AF on long-term outcomes after stroke.

Methods: In this prospective cohort study, 353 patients with acute ischemic stroke or transient ischemic attacks were analyzed.

Background And Purpose: Contradictory evidence on the impact of single sleep-wake-disturbances (SWD), such as sleep-disorderd breating (SDB) or insomnia, in patients with stroke, on the risk of subsequent cardio- and cerebrovascular events (CCE) and death, exists. Very recent studies in the general population suggest that the presence of multiple SWD increases cardio-cerebrovascular risk. Hence, the aim of this study was to asssess whether a novel score capturing the burden of multiple SWD, a so called "sleep burden index", is predictive for subsequent CCE including death in a prospectively followed cohort of stroke patients.

Understanding which factors predict the outcome of internet-based cognitive behavioral therapy for insomnia (iCBT-I) may help to tailor this intervention to the patient's needs. We have conducted a secondary analysis of a randomized, controlled trial comparing a multicomponent iCBT-I (MCT) and an online sleep restriction therapy (SRT) for 83 chronic insomnia patients. The difference in the Insomnia Severity Index from pre- to post-treatment and from pre-treatment to follow-up at 6 months after treatment was the dependent variable.

Background: Sleep-disordered breathing (SDB) is highly prevalent in acute ischaemic stroke and is associated with worse functional outcome and increased risk of recurrence. Recent meta-analyses suggest the possibility of beneficial effects of nocturnal ventilatory treatments (continuous positive airway pressure (CPAP) or adaptive servo-ventilation (ASV)) in stroke patients with SDB. The evidence for a favourable effect of early SDB treatment in acute stroke patients remains, however, uncertain.

Guidelines recommend cognitive behavioural therapy for insomnia (CBT-I) as first-line treatment for chronic insomnia, but it is not clear how many primary care physicians (PCPs) in Switzerland prescribe this treatment. We created a survey that asked PCPs how they would treat chronic insomnia and how much they knew about CBT-I. The survey included two case vignettes that described patients with chronic insomnia, one with and one without comorbid depression.

We investigated the prevalence and treatment of patients with chronic insomnia presenting to Swiss primary care physicians (PCPs) part of "Sentinella", a nationwide practice-based research network. Each PCP consecutively asked 40 patients if they had sleep complaints, documented frequency, duration, comorbidities, and reported ongoing treatment. We analysed data of 63% (83/132) of the PCPs invited.

Background: Internet-based cognitive behavioral treatment (iCBT-I) for insomnia comprising different sleep-related cognitive and behavioral interventional components has shown some promise. However, it is not known which components are necessary for a good treatment outcome.

Method: People suffering from insomnia (N = 104) without any other comorbid psychiatric disorders were randomized (2:2:1) to two guided internet-based self-help interventions for insomnia [multi-component cognitive behavioral self-help intervention (MCT); sleep restriction intervention for insomnia (SRT)], and care as usual [CAU].

Purpose Of Review: Sleep-wake disorders (SWD) are common not only in the general population but also in stroke patients, in whom SWD may be pre-existent or appear "de novo" as a consequence of brain damage. Despite increasing evidence of a negative impact of SWD on cardiocerebrovascular risk, cognitive functions, and quality of life, SWD are insufficiently considered in the prevention and management of patients with stroke. This narrative review aims at summarizing the current data on the bidirectional link between SWD and stroke.

Various studies suggest that non-rapid eye movement (NREM) sleep, especially slow-wave sleep (SWS), is vital to the consolidation of declarative memories. However, sleep stage 2 (S2), which is the other NREM sleep stage besides SWS, has gained only little attention. The current study investigated whether S2 during an afternoon nap contributes to the consolidation of declarative memories.
